    House Fire In Oswego Township Claims Victim, Pet

    A house fire in Oswego Township early Sunday morning claimed the life of one inhabitant and a pet, according to the Oswego Fire Protection District.

    According to a press release, at approximately 6:27am Sunday, firefighters were called to a residence in the 30 block of Fernwood Road in unincorporated Oswego Township to investigate outside smoke. Upon arriving , they discovered a structural fire and immediately ordered a General Alarm.

    While firefighters initiated an aggressive interior attack to bring the fire under control, searches of the residence resulted in the identification of a deceased resident along with a deceased pet.

    The fire was ultimately knocked down and firefighters remained to ensure complete extinguishment.

    No injuries to firefighters were reported. The residence sustained significant damage and was deemed uninhabitable.
